However, my topic today is about how you, you want to change something that maybe you're doing and you don't even know you're doing it. So if you use affirmations, like I was reading that L Friedman, the Amazing podcaster does, uh, some ritual every morning with affirmations, and that's cool for him. That's really cool for him. And he has a very different set of rules and things that he's been living by and working from, but most people have something that stops them even more, and it's not expecting things to work out. So most people can do affirmations, but most people like lacks who do affirmations, they expect things to work out. Uh, the moral majority of people all over who've had any difficulty actually expect things to not work out for them. And their habit and their muscle system around not having things work out for them, and those expectations is, let's just say it's so low that, well, if it doesn't happen, then I won't be disappointed. And that I hear from folks a lot. So if you think about your own expectations, do you expect the best? Do you expect things to work out for you? Do you expect that good will come to you? Do you expect to find a solution, find an answer, find a way through to find an opportunity? Do you expect what could work as opposed to expecting things to fail? That's the big question for you today, and I think it's something that you probably want to apply every day. There's something that I have posted on a little note, um, on my desk, and it's about a reminder. It's not an affirmation. It's a reminder to stay true to that idea. And so what I'm suggesting right here, right now is put a post-it note that you get to see every day, whether it's on your mirror, in your car, on your mirror. I had some clients a bunch of years ago, Uh, take this idea and they plastered their rear view mirror with these, uh, with these post-it notes. And it's cute. I'll find the picture someday. I think it's actually on my blog. And the idea of expectation is I expect good things. I expect the best. I expect more than I have expected before. Those kind of things at least get you moving in the right direction. And then start thinking about how you are not expecting things to work out for you and clean that up.
